Johnny Depp News: Actor, as Captain Jack Sparrow, Visits Children's Hospital in Australia

Who knew pirates had such big hearts, well apparently Captain Jack Sparrow played by actor Johnny Depp has one huge heart as he recently paid a quick visit to a children's hospital in Australia all dressed-up in his famous Disney costume.

Apparently this is always how the renowned actor, Depp travels whenever he is in a certain country for a shooting of his films and other work-related trips. He reportedly always make sure that he visits a hospital or any institution of kids in need.

This time, Depp, who was then wearing his Captain Jack Sparrow outfit from the famous film series 'Pirates of The Caribbean' went for a quick visit at the Lady Cilento Children's Hospital just to put big smiles on the children's faces. Depp was focused on visiting those children who couldn't get up from their hospital beds, giving them hugs or taking fun photos with them.

Reportedly, Depp or Capt. Jack Sparrow rode a black helicopter to go to the hospital and when the children saw him, they were so happy that Depp made their day special. "He was going from room to room seeing all the kids who couldn't get out of bed," a mother of a patient named Max Bennet, Rachel told ABC.net in Australia. "We waited out of the front of one of the rooms, and he came up to us and had a really good chat to Max."

Rachel continued to describe how Depp was very compassionate with the children saying, "It was really beautiful. Everyone kept on trying to move him on, but he kept on coming back."

Depp always had a big heart for children even telling it himself in his previous interview with E! News. "Sometimes you go to kiddie hospitals and things like that," the actor explained while promoting his film The Lone Ranger in 2013. "I'll just sneak in and go and surprise a bunch of kiddies through the different wards...It basically turns into a two-, three-hour improvisation and it's really fun. So I travel with Captain Jack," he added.
